Their One Love is a fascinating glimpse into early 20th-century storytelling, encapsulating an intricate tangle of emotions against the backdrop of the Civil War. The pacing feels deliberate, allowing the character dynamics to unfold in a way that really captures the tension between the twins' shared love and individual desires. The practical effects, while primitive by today’s standards, add a certain charm to the action sequences, and the performances—though not always polished—carry an earnestness that makes their struggles feel very real. There's a certain atmospheric quality to the film, reflective of its time, that draws you into the world of the 1850s amidst the chaos of war.
Their One Love is a silent gem that rarely pops up in collector circles, often overshadowed by more prominent titles of its time. The film's format has seen limited preservation efforts, making original prints quite scarce. Collectors tend to appreciate it for its early exploration of complex emotional themes and the unique narrative structure, marking it as an interesting find for those who delve into silent film history.
